January Weather in Chibougamau, Canada

Last updated: June 18, 2025

In January, the average temperature in Chibougamau, Canada hovers around -17°C (2°F). During this chilly month, temperatures can plummet to a minimum of -38°C (-37°F), while the rare maximum peaks at 4°C (39°F). Expect 49 mm (1.9 in) of precipitation spread over 12 days, contributing to an average humidity level of a staggering 97%. Prepare for a brisk and damp winter experience!

How January Weather in Chibougamau Compares to Other Months

Weather in Chibougamau var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ares January’s weather to other months in Chibougamau,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Chibougamau, showing how January’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-17°C (2°F)49 mm (1.9 inches)97%low
February Weather-16°C (4°F)54 mm (2.1 inches)96%moderate
March Weather-9°C (15°F)59 mm (2.3 inches)94%moderate
April Weather-1°C (30°F)66 mm (2.6 inches)91%high
May Weather6°C (42°F)81 mm (3.2 inches)79%very high
June Weather12°C (55°F)88 mm (3.4 inches)71%very high
July Weather16°C (62°F)116 mm (4.6 inches)81%very high
August Weather16°C (60°F)142 mm (5.6 inches)83%high
September Weather11°C (52°F)134 mm (5.3 inches)82%high
October Weather4°C (40°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)90%moderate
November Weather-4°C (25°F)110 mm (4.3 inches)93%low
December Weather-13°C (10°F)83 mm (3.3 inches)97%low
